Summary: This research aims at developing a decision support system for scheduling and
routing vehicles dedicated to transporting handicapped people (Dial -a-Ride Problem),
considering dynamic factors. For this, a review related to wheelchair transportation is
presented, as well as the main laws and statistics of the area, the main methods and
concepts of dynamic scheduling and routing of vehicles (Dynamic Routing Problem)
and also the methods and concepts of information system development. Amongst the
methods of dynamic scheduling and routing presented, the insertion heuristics
method stands out, method which is used as a reference for this research and was
applied in it. The system was developed in VBA language (Visual Basic for
Applications), and was tested with real data of 20 days of operation of the wheelchair
transportation system located in the Vitória metropolitan area, the Serviço Especial
Mão na Roda, which contained a total of 3,525 users registered by July/2014. In
order to accomplish the tests of the proposed system and analyze its outputs, the
results of the 20 samples selected were analyzed based on the distance increase on
the routes due to the attendance of the new so licitations, processing times, demand
of new solicitations and capability of insertion within the routes, according to results
presented by the program. Moreover, the data was compared with the scheduling
results from empirical methods used by the scheduling center and the schedule
proposed by de system. The results show that the proposed system is capable of
inserting new solicitations dynamically onto existing routes, with an average
computational processing time of five seconds/request. Finally, the research resulted
in the development of a software which was registered at the Instituto Nacional da
Propriedade Industrial.
